Mind-Body Medicine
is a holistic approach to mental health care that focuses on the interconnectedness of the mind, body, and spirit. This field of study recognizes that mental health is influenced by a range of factors, including genetics, environment, and lifestyle choices.
By exploring the complex relationships between physical and emotional well-being, Mind-Body Medicine aims to promote overall health and resilience.
